The 2025 WNBA season opens with the New York Liberty (+230) looking to defend their championship crown against a number of contenders. The Indiana Fever (+350), led by superstar guard Caitlin Clark, look to be among the top teams in the league after their first-round playoff exit last season. The Fever and Las Vegas Aces (+350) are tied for the second-shortest odds to win the WNBA Finals this season. Behind them is the Minnesota Lynx (+400) and Napheesa Collier, who looks to make her case for the WNBA MVP after finishing runner-up to A'ja Wilson a season ago.
